We live in an era in which any attempt at judgment seems to be regarded as a provocation.. To suggest, for example, that the willing integration of homosexuals into the military services will destroy morale and the spirit needed to maintain discipline, is viewed as hogwash, the vestige of some antiquated past when people lacked understanding. There seems to have been a collapse of monumental proportions of people’s ability to evaluate and judge situations — not only that one — and there is scarcely a word of protest across the land.

Is this because almost everyone buys into the prevailing judgment, or is it because so many do not want to be the target of opprobrium?

Whatever the proposition, discrimination has suffered yet another blow. But while an unwillingness to take a stance is one dimension of civilizational decline, it does not compare in passion or intensity to preemptive capitulation, a desire to support the very movements that exist that openly state as their aim to undermine the West. Worse, the more extreme the movement, the more you find ardent defenders. Jihadists in the United States and Europe, for instance, state without equivocation a desire to create caliphates across the globe and to introduce sharia law as a legal precedent.

Remarkably those on the left, who once renounced orthodoxies of any kind, now embrace the totalistic dimensions of Islam. They insist that the full panoply of civil rights be given to foreign combatants (read: terrorists). They contend that the Islamic faith promotes peace, even when every even the Islamists state that Islam is designed to place the non-believer in a position of submission.

The Danish government that once stood up to Islamic intimidation has seemingly collapsed. Now one minister after another finds some justification for Islamic violence; a rationalization that makes a rational, common-sense defense of Western traditions untenable. And, as many judicial officials opt to maintain order rather than confront extremists, this is rapidly becoming the European defense model

Can the West withstand this dual attack, one a breakdown of judgmental standards, and the other, a capitulation to the most radical forces on center stage? My answer is “yes” — IF the West wakes up from its ideological slumber and attempts to slaughter this dragon of intimidation.

As Adam Smith noted “there’s a great deal of ruin in a nation” — and in a civilization. “The future is unknowable,” as Winston Churchill pointed out in A History of The English Speaking Peoples, “but the past should give us hope.”

Overcoming war, poverty, tragedy, brutality and murder suggests that mankind possesses the instinct for self preservation, even if it isn’t immediately apparent. We root for self realization and self preservation even as we fail to see our failures. Can history resort to a turning back to Dark Ages, where standards of any kind are in disarray except the standard of Might Makes Right?

It may seem that way at this moment, but recovery may be around the corner as an anti-toxin. History has a way of being pliable and unpredictable, stretching unimagined scenarios of replenishment and before just as the hour looks most bleak.
